Western Himalayan Region: The Western Himalayan Region covers Jammu and Kashmir, Himachal Pradesh and the hill region of. Uttarakhand. The valley floors grow rice, while the hilly tracts grow maize in the kharif season. Winter. crops are Barley, Oats, and Wheat.
